Teacher Notes

A. Prior to the lesson:

1. Arrange students into groups. Each group needs at least ONE person who has a mobile device.

2. If their phone camera doesn't automatically detect and decode QR codes, ask students to

3. Print out the QR codes.

4. Cut them out and place them around your class / school.


B. The lesson:

1. Give each group a clipboard and a piece of paper so they can write down the decoded questions and their answers to them.

2. Explain to the students that the codes are hidden around the school. Each team will get ONE point for each question they correctly decode and copy down onto their sheet, and a further TWO points if they can then provide the correct answer and write this down underneath the question.

3. Away they go! The winner is the first team to return with the most correct answers in the time available. This could be within a lesson, or during a lunchbreak, or even over several days!

Questions / Answers (teacher reference)

Question

Answer

1. Government in the colonies of British North America before Confederation was neither representative nor responsible. Describe what both representative and responsible government means
2. How was government structured in Upper and Lower Canada before Confederation? Who had all the power? Who would want responsible government?
3. The government of Upper Canada was established in 1791 by the Constitutional Act, what did this Act do?
4. Why were there issues created by having a governor?
5. What were some reasons people were upset in Upper Canada?
6. What were some reasons people were upset in Lower Canada? How did these reasons differ from those in Upper Canada? Why did these reasons work to encourage Confederation?
7. In 1837, Upper Canada rebelled against the injustices it saw in the colony. What were the main reasons for rebellion in Upper Canada?
8. What were the main reasons for rebellion in Lower Canada in 1837?
9. Who recommended joining Lower Canada and Upper Canada together and what was the report called? Put Upper & Lower Canada together.
10. What were Upper and Lower Canada called once they were joined?
11. Lord Durham recommended responsible government for the colonies. Provide a simple explanation as to what “Responsible Government” is.
12. What is the Act of Union and were the British in favour or not?
13. What are some reasons as to why people were unsure about Responsible Government?
14. What was the main idea behind the Corn Laws? How did the repealing of the Corn laws push Canada towards Confederation?
15. Under the leadership of Lord Elgin, what was the purpose of Responsible Government?
